WebbA for loop is a repetition control structure that allows you to efficiently write a loop that needs to execute a specific number of times. Syntax The syntax of a for loop in C# is − for ( init; condition; increment ) { statement (s); } Here is the flow of control in a for loop − The init step is executed first, and only once. Webb26 apr. 2024 · For loops are useful when you want to execute the same code for each item in a given sequence. With a for loop, you can iterate over any iterable data such as lists, sets, tuples, dictionaries, ranges, and even strings. In this article, I will show you how the for loop works in Python. The functionality of the for loop isn’t very different from what you see in multiple other programming languages. css prevent selectionWebbA for loop has two parts: a header specifying the iteration, and a body which is executed once per iteration. The header often declares an explicit loop counter or loop variable, which allows the body to know which iteration is being executed. For loops are typically used when the number of iterations is known before entering the loop. earl spencer black folks camp too
